South Dakota Farm Awarded Top Honors at Iowa State Fair Dexter Show

DES MOINES, IA (09/02/2011)(readMedia)-- Terry Sprague of Audubon netted the Grand Champion Female honors in the Dexter Cattle Show Thursday, August 18, at the 2011 Iowa State Fair.

High Pines Dexters of Hot Springs, S.D. captured the Grand Champion Bull and Reserve Grand Champion Female banners. Timberview Dexters of Coon Rapids showed the Reserve Grand Champion Bull.
